Be wise to the unREAL(ities)

As women and girls our lives can become ruled by unrealistic images and ideals—what we call unREAL(ities):

#1 Pressure to compete with our peers, to make the grade and to compare ourselves to others. This pushes us to try to be like everyone else except the REAL us. For example, 74% of girls say they are under pressure to please everyone (Girls Inc.).

#2 Packaging is the focus—from celeb magazines to reality TV and the Web—we're encouraged to invest too much time and attention into our outside appearance and material assets to get attention. This leads to negative body image and an empty feeling inside. We are getting the message that: "you're nobody until everybody on the planet loves your look."

#3 Perfection and narrow ideals of beauty, success and power makes us feel that we aren't good enough and that nothing we do is good enough.

In reality, our REAL potential is limitless and so are the opportunities in life. Let's encourage each other to develop our REAL assets and gifts which are boundless and come from the inside! See the Getting REAL Tour.
